Understanding Exchange Fees
Before diving into the Best Lowest Fee Crypto Exchange low-fee exchanges, it's important to comprehend the kinds of fees commonly associated with cryptocurrency trading:
Trading fees: Fees charged when buying or offering cryptocurrencies.Withdrawal fees: Charges for transferring crypto out of the exchange to a wallet.Deposit fees: Fees incurred when adding funds to the exchange.Lack of exercise fees: Charges applied when an account is non-active for a given duration.
Some exchanges have no trading fees but may enforce high withdrawal fees, which can affect your total profitability.

Why do crypto exchanges charge fees?
Crypto exchanges charge fees to cover operating expense, including security, innovation, and consumer service workers expenditures.
2. What is the difference between maker and taker fees?Maker fees use when you add liquidity to the order book by placing a limitation order, whereas taker fees apply when you get rid of liquidity by performing an order against an existing one.3. Are zero-fee exchanges trustworthy?
Not necessarily. Some zero-fee exchanges might make up for the lost profits with greater withdrawal fees or may have hidden charges. Research is vital for ensuring reliability.
4. Can fees change in time?
Yes, fees can change based upon trading volume, exchange policies, and market conditions. Constantly describe the exchange's main fee schedule for updates.
5. What are KYC requirements, and why do they matter?
KYC (Know Your Customer) requirements are regulatory protocols that exchanges follow to verify the identity of users. This procedure boosts security and compliance however may slow down the onboarding procedure.
